The Barung Nursery Tent RECOGNITION OF for local native plants TRADITIONAL OWNERS The Maleny Wood Expo is being held on the traditional lands of the Jinibara people and we wish to acknowledge them as Traditional Owners. We would also like to pay our respects to their Elders, past and present, and the Elders from other communities who may be in attendance. The D.A.R Woodworm 0437201481 Thedarwoodworm.com 50 18 19 Barung Landcare Nursery at the Maleny Wood Expo The Barung Landcare Community Nursery has an extensive nursery dedicated to species local to the Sunshine Coast Hinterland as well as a wide range of fauna and flora publications. All sales benefit protection & restoration of the Sunshine Coast Hinterland for the community.
